Exposed line on outhaul let go last night while racing.  In boom wire it was attached to seems fine, just need some idea how to get a new line reattached to the wire, in to the boom where the inset block attaches to the bottom of the boom.  I'm guessing I need to take the aft boom cap off an do some fishing, but does anyone know how the wire runs inside the boom?

That is correct Ron, you need to remove the end cap on the end of the boom and you will then have access to that wire end. You'll have to remove the front cap as well as that will show you how the 2:1 rope system was attached. It all makes sense once it's apart. 

Sometimes the block that is swaged onto the wire end needs to be replaced. You'll understand once it's all apart.
